CMTA, formerly known as AMA Group, is hiring a Project Engineer, Commissioning, who will be responsible for preforming building and systems commissioning work on a range of both small and large projects. This is a hands-on role that will be given the opportunity to lead projects and represent CMTA in all interactions with clients, contractors, architects, and other project team members. In this role, the Project Engineer will receive guidance and mentorship from the commissioning group leader and will be trained to become a Project Manager.
- Write comprehensive reports which include the following sections: recommendations for optimizing building operations (Energy Audits)
- Create documents such as commissioning plans, commissioning reports, design qualification equipment, facility and utility protocols, and final reports
- Manage several concurrent projects that are in various stages of design, construction, and warranty periods
- Prepare data and visualizations such as tables, charts, accurate reports, sketches, calculations, technical drawings, spreadsheets, and 2D/3D illustrations for the interpretation or presentation of data, findings, or analyses
- Perform professional building and system commissioning work by conducting research and inspections of proposed and existing site conditions, equipment, resources, layout, usage, and systems to determine conformance with applicable rules, standards, codes, and installation or operating permits

- Proficient with technical writing of documents such as: commissioning plans (CMP): user requirements specifications (URS), risk assessments (RA), factory acceptance tests (FAT), site acceptance tests (SAT), pre-functional tests (PFT), functional tests (FT), commissioning test plans (CTP), integrated system tests (IST), maintenance, calibration, and spare parts
- Education: Bachelors in Engineering or related discipline, or equivalent experience
- LEED Commissioning Fundamental, Enhanced and Monitoring Based Commissioning
- 3-5years' experience in commissioning or MEP design
- Local travel to project sites; there may be travel to California, New Jersey, and Miami as needed
- Knowledgeable of mechanical, electrical, and automation systems: ability to read, interpret, and correct P&IDs, and experience with working in construction environments
